Wednesday, November 26, 2008 @ 09:36:33 AM Sorry to double post but i just found this "The official editor for Fallout 3, called the G.E.C.K. (Garden of Eden Creation Kit), will be available for free download in December and will allow PC users to create and add their own content to the game. The release of the G.E.C.K. provides the community with tools that will allow players to expand the game. Users can create, modify, and edit any data for use with Fallout 3, from building landscapes, towns, and locations to writing dialogue, creating characters, weapons, creatures, and more. The G.E.C.K. will likely have a interface simliar to The Elder Scrolls Construction Kit" Taken from "http://fallout.wikia.com/wiki/Fallout_3_downloadable_content"
